With Google Play Services, you can authenticate Google services, synchronize your contacts, access the latest user privacy settings, and use higher quality location-based Goto Settings > Apps. Scroll to All apps and then scroll down to “Google Play Store” app. Open the app details and tap on the “Force stop” button. Then, tap on the “Clear cache” button. That’s it. Now start the Google Play Store app on your phone / tablet and it should load and work absolutely fine! Solution 4 -. u9OK.
